There are two types for electricians: apprenticeships and associate degree programs. Associate degree programs can be completed within two years and prepare students for licensure as electricians.

An apprenticeship program is an individualized and comprehensive learning opportunity that teaches the basics of the trade. In addition to the classroom time the apprentice will often be working alongside an experienced master electrician.

You'll learn how to read blueprints, circuit diagrams and other technical documents. You'll also learn about electrical standards and safety procedures.

An electrician is essential for numerous construction projects, including renovations and new construction. They are able to safely and efficiently execute electrical plans drafted by architects or designers.

You must pass an examination and have at minimum two years experience as an electrician before you can become licensed. This is the minimum requirement in the majority of states. To prove your expertise in specific areas of electrical trade, it is possible to apply for national certifications. These certifications can help you stand out potential clients and employers and increase your earning potential.

Check the License

It is essential to verify the qualifications of any electrician you employ. You could put your business or home at risk if the electrician is not licensed.

The Department of Buildings issues electrical licenses in New York. The licenses are Master Electrician and Special Electrician. An investigation into the background of the applicant is required for all licenses.

A high school diploma, GED certificate, and some working experience are the minimum requirements for obtaining an authorization. Additionally, you must pass a written exam and a practical test. You also need to complete a few hours each year of continuing education.

It is not an easy job to get an electrician's licence. In some cities, it can take up to four years to get a journeyman's license.
